Odd Realm is a simulation game set in a procedurally generated, fantasy world where you foster a group of Settlers to help them build, explore, and survive... probably...

Pretty fun overall. Kind of like an ever-expansive version of Rimworld with more pixelated graphics and a lot more going on under the hood, or so it seems.

There's a lot of things all hitting at once with it, and honestly it's more than a little overwhelming. I didn't see any sort of tutorial (and if there was I missed it) and so I didn't feel as comfortable with starting it as I did with Rimworld.

It's still pretty fun but honestly between the two I'll just play Rim.

A wonderful pixel Sim colony builder with soothing music and a lot of charm. It's constantly being updated and expanded to offer more types of settlers and more things to do. It's a bit of Dwarf Fortress with less tantrum cascades. Build towns, level mountains, dig way down into the terrible depths of the earth for goodies and get destroyed by angry skeletons.

More people should play this, particularly if you're like me and you enjoy a solid colony-builder that also happens to have some simple combat.
